求助:stc52单片机无法下载

[复制链接]
3730|7
 楼主| ishort 发表于 2008-12-17 02:28 | 显示全部楼层 |阅读模式
都怪自己太激动,把程序改好编译后马上就点了ISP的下载,这时单片机电源开着,还在运行前一个写进去的程序,然后发现无法下载了。

把P1.0和P1.1接地,还可以下载了。

请问下,有没有其它补救的办法,毕竟学习板上插两个飞线很不爽。

还请达人解释下这是问什么呢?刚学不久,还望指教!
muslimsali 发表于 2008-12-17 08:41 | 显示全部楼层

问题问的不清

把P1.0和P1.1接地,还可以下载了。

什么意思,感觉打错字了。

stc的下载程序要先点下载后再给单片机加电的。

它还可以用普通的编程器给它写程序的。
xzl 发表于 2008-12-17 11:24 | 显示全部楼层

是你修改了下载条件

 楼主| ishort 发表于 2008-12-17 12:13 | 显示全部楼层

看图片

必须把图片中蓝色的部分选中才能下载,而选择“与下载无关”就无法正常下载!
lyjian 发表于 2008-12-17 22:06 | 显示全部楼层

把P1.0和P1.1接地,进入ISP方式

然后选择下次令启动P1.0,P1.1与下载无关再重新下载
 楼主| ishort 发表于 2008-12-18 00:25 | 显示全部楼层

5楼

现在的问题就是选择“与下载无关”时不行,不知道可否挽救!
lxxz2001@sohu 发表于 2008-12-18 16:45 | 显示全部楼层

下载设置

选择“P1.0,P1.1与下载无关”,就不用考虑P1.0,P1.1的电平状态。默认下载方式。

P1.0,P1.1与下载有关就要把P1.0和P1.1接地,才可以下载。

注意,STC设置好后需要按上电复位键才能下载。



lxxz2001@sohu 发表于 2008-12-18 16:49 | 显示全部楼层

问题原因

你发生的原因可能是你的运行程序中有串口通讯,在程序运行过程中下载程序,串口线上的数据导致进入BOOT区运行时无法判断进入用户代码还是进入程序下载代码,出错
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1

主题

5

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部